Can Turtles Eat Boiled Eggs?
Yes, turtles can eat boiled eggs. Boiled eggs are an excellent source of protein, as well as many vitamins and minerals. Boiled eggs are a great treat for turtles, as they are easy to digest and provide the animal with a boost of energy. Boiled eggs can be a great addition to a turtle’s diet, as long as they are fed in moderation.
The Benefits of Boiled Eggs for Turtles
Boiled eggs are a great source of protein, vitamins, and minerals for turtles. The protein in boiled eggs helps turtles build muscle and promote overall health. Boiled eggs also provide turtles with essential fatty acids, which are important for healthy skin and shell development. Additionally, boiled eggs provide turtles with phosphorus, which is needed for bone development.
The Best Way to Boil Eggs for Turtles
It’s important to boil eggs for turtles properly to ensure that the animal is getting the nutrition it needs. The best way to prepare boiled eggs for turtles is to hard-boil them. This means that the eggs should be cooked for around 10 to 12 minutes in boiling water. It’s also important to make sure that the eggs are completely cooled before serving them to the turtle.
How Often
Can Turtles Eat Boiled Eggs?
Turtles should not be fed boiled eggs on a daily basis. Boiled eggs should only be given to turtles as an occasional treat or snack, no more than once a week. As with any type of food, it’s important to feed turtles in moderation to avoid any health issues.
Troubleshooting Tips for Feeding Boiled Eggs to Turtles
When feeding boiled eggs to turtles, it’s important to make sure that the eggs are fully cooked and cooled before feeding them to the animal. Additionally, it’s important to ensure that the turtle is not being overfed. Too much protein in a turtle’s diet can lead to health issues such as obesity and respiratory infections.
